Transaction 6814e5172ff3c751842eaf269287f8fb02f602bd5a093c78d8010e18a8714b32

1 Input
2 Outputs
  • 6814e5172ff3c751842eaf269287f8fb02f602bd5a093c78d8010e18a8714b32:0
  • value  289998739
    address  n1f2qm82vLUxsUYFCsuAEqSWtZuccbtdnQ
  • 6814e5172ff3c751842eaf269287f8fb02f602bd5a093c78d8010e18a8714b32:1
  • value  100000
    address  2MweU6nd2EkEZMJsLenx9h54zPF84UKSXGE